Watering Rosemary
· Give rosemary a deep watering every one to two weeks rather than frequent, short waterings. The water should penetrate into the soil to encourage strong, deep root systems, which helps them access moisture and nutrients they need during droughts. · A newly planted rosemary needs to be watered frequently for the first week or two to help it become established, but after it's been established, it needs little in the way of watering other than rainfall. The most common and straightforward way to water rosemary is to just pour water onto the soil around the plant and while that generally works fine, there is often a better way to do it. It depends on how you grow it, though. Soil pH affects how well plants take up nutrients. Garden soils that are either too acidic or alkaline make it hard for plants to absorb the nutrients they need. · There are a variety of ways you can lower soil pH. One is to apply organic mulch that is high in acidity, like oak leaves or pine needles. As they break down, they'll increase the acidity of the soil beneath. Another is…
